The topochemical antennal sense also furnishes splendid proofs of
memory in ants, bees, etc. An ant may perform an arduous journey of
thirty meters from her ruined nest, there find a place suitable for
building another nest, return, orienting herself by means of her
antenna, seize a companion who forthwith rolls herself about her
abductrix, and is carried to the newly selected spot. The latter then
also finds her way to the original nest, and both each carry back
another companion, etc. The memory of the suitable nature of the
locality for establishing a new nest must exist in the brain of the
first ant or she would not return, laden with a companion, to this
very spot. The slave-making ants (_Polyergus_) undertake predatory
expeditions, led by a few workers, who for days and weeks previously
have been searching the neighborhood for nests of _Formica fusca_. The
ants often lose their way, remain standing and hunt about for a long
time till one or the other finds the topochemical trail and indicates
to the others the direction to be followed by rapidly pushing ahead.
Then the pupæ of the _Formica fusca_ nest, which they have found, are
brought up from the depths of the galleries, appropriated and dragged
home, often a distance of forty meters or more. If the plundered nest
still contains pupæ, the robbers return on the same or following days
and carry off the remainder, but if there are no pupæ left they do not
return. How do the Polyergus know whether there are pupæ remaining?
It can be demonstrated that smell could not attract them from such
a distance, and this is even less possible for sight or any other
sense. Memory alone, i. e., the recollection that many pupæ still
remain behind in the plundered nest can induce them to return. I have
carefully followed a great number of these predatory expeditions.
While Formica species follow their topochemical trail with great
difficulty over new roads, they nevertheless know the immediate
surroundings of their nest so well that even shovelling away the earth
can scarcely disconcert them, and they find their way at once, as
Wasmann emphatically states and as I myself have often observed. That
this cannot be due to smelling at long range can be demonstrated in
another manner, for the olfactory powers of the genus Formica, like
those of honey-bees, are not sufficiently acute for this purpose, as
has been shown in innumerable experiments by all connoisseurs of these
animals. Certain ants can recognise friends even after the expiration
of months. In ants and bees there are very complex combinations and
mixtures of odors, which Von Buttel has very aptly distinguished as
nest-odor, colony- (family-) odor, and individual odor. In ants we have
in addition a species-odor, while the queen-odor does not play the same
rôle as among bees.
